Does religion cause war? It’s a firm yes from British zoologist and vocal atheist Richard Dawkins, who sees a direct correlation between the two.

Upheaval in Afghanistan highlights the horrors of conflict

It’s hard to know where to begin when it comes to the situation currently unfolding in Afghanistan.